Why Is Being a Certified Woman-Owned Business Important to You?

When I came across the Woman-Owned Business certification, I realized it was something I needed to do for Hammersmith Support. Being in a male-dominated industry, this certification gives us one more way to set ourselves apart from our competition.

From the business side, being a Certified Woman-Owned Business gives us access to government contracts and other opportunities, as well as increased visibility with our clients.

What Are 3 Tips You Have for Other Entrepreneurs?

  • Don’t be afraid to delegate. There’s a limit to how much we can do on our own – surround yourself with people you trust, and then trust them to do what you ask them.
  • I read this quote and it has always stuck with me; “If you’re going to eat Moby Dick, bring tartar sauce.” Having a successful mindset, even when you’re not quite there yet, is key. Always present yourself as a successful person.
  • Surround yourself with people who are smarter than you. Let their knowledge be the driver pushing you to the next level.
